Transaction 5ef20738cf5a3eb66e248e509d35facac994bf8aefa69b5f5a6291a6b4fa162f

1 Input
2 Outputs
  • 5ef20738cf5a3eb66e248e509d35facac994bf8aefa69b5f5a6291a6b4fa162f:0
  • value  25834
    address  38a8iLvy5nKELCzs5CWMkW6D2e7wvFXZfz
  • 5ef20738cf5a3eb66e248e509d35facac994bf8aefa69b5f5a6291a6b4fa162f:1
  • value  1144798
    address  3FMGrxLLXMLyzeyYSDEU3XRyq1bt1VwhdT